Main Menu Controls

Main Menu Controls

Adjust the menu items shown below by using the up and down buttons.

Control Explanation

Auto Image Adjust sizes and centers the screen image automatically.

Contrast adjusts the difference between the image background (black level) and the foreground (white level).

Brightness adjusts background black level of the screen image.

Input Select toggles between inputs if you have more than one computer.

Color Adjust provides several color adjustment modes: preset color temperatures and RGB which allows you to adjust red (R), green (G), and blue (B) separately. The factory setting for this product is 6500K (6500 Kelvin).

sRGB sRGB is quickly becoming the industry standard for color management, with support being included in many of the latest applications. Enabling this setting allows the LCD display to more accurately display colors the way they were originally intended. Enabling the sRGB setting will cause the Contrast and Brightness adjustments to be disabled.

9300K — Adds blue to the screen image for cooler white (used in most office settings with fluorescent lighting).

6500K — Adds red to the screen image for warmer white and richer red.

5400K — Adds green to the screen image for a darker color.

5000K — Adds blue and green to the screen image for a darker color.
